Stunning century home in the heart of the Durand neighbourhood. This fabulous family home on a quiet side street has been meticulously renovated from top to bottom inside and out!! Exceptional curb appeal with interlock driveway, walkways, porch and awnings invite you to knock on the customized front door. Inside you are greeted by a spacious hallway that lead to a stunning living room with custom panelled feature wall showcasing the gas fireplace, flanked by chic sconces, a nod to blending modern design with timeless character. Hardwood floors, dentil molding and original arch with cornice moldings connect the living room to an elegant dining room perfect for entertaining family and friends. The gourmet kitchen features gran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, mosaic backsplash, abundant storage and passthrough to the dining room so you are always part of the conversation, plus a sweet powder room off to the side. Step out the kitchen door to the spacious 17x13ft covered back porch and enjoy extra outdoor living space overlooking a lovely landscaped yard with perennial gardens and ambient lighting. Upstairs features three spacious bedrooms with custom millwork, California shutters, new flooring and a chic 4-pc spa-like bath with stained glass transom. A bright spacious attic with vaulted ceilings, skylights, gleaming wood floors and 3-piece bath, offers great space as a family room, home gym, or primary suite. The waterproofed basement provides ample storage and a unique soundproof music room/den/mancave with copper ceiling tiles. Major updates include, roof, driveway, walkways, porch, deck, lighting, kitchen, bathrooms, flooring, trim, see detailed list is attached in the supplements. Located just minutes from Locke St S. restaurants, coffee shops, boutiques, schools, parks, trails, golf, St. Josephs or McMaster Hospital and Hwy 403, make this a fabulous location and family home just waiting for its next owners to move in and enjoy.
